HYANNIS PORT – Seven people were rescued after becoming stranded by the incoming tide on the Hyannis Port Jetty. The Hyannis Fire Boat responded about 8:15 PM Thursday and brought the individuals safely to shore. They were evaluated but declined further treatment. The post Stranded people rescued…

DEDHAM, Mass. (AP) — A jury found Karen Read not guilty of second-degree murder Wednesday in the death of her Boston police officer boyfriend John O’Keefe. Read, a Mansfield resident, was found guilty of a lesser charge of drunken driving. The verdict comes nearly a year after a separate jury deadlocked…
